
Senior PCIe Firmware Engineer
at Nvidia
Posted 18 hours ago
No clicks
- Compensation
- Not specified
- City
- Not specified
- Country
- Israel
Currency: Not specified
We are hiring a Senior PCIe Firmware Engineer for the Chip Design PCIe Firmware team. You will work on groundbreaking technology network adapters and help build core technology for NVIDIA devices, focusing on low-level C firmware between hardware and firmware, automation challenges, and Python testing environments. Responsibilities include implementing firmware and verification features in pre- and post-silicon PCIe environments, collaborating with chip design, verification, FW, SW, and architecture teams, and improving automated processes.
We are hiring a Senior PCIe Firmware to the Chip Design PCIe Firmware team. You will be joining a team whose primary mission is to work on groundbreaking technology network adapters and build the core technology of the next generation NVIDIA devices in a wide range of fields - low-level C layer between HW and FWs, automation challenges, and Python testing environment.
What you’ll be doing:
implement FW and verification features in a pre and post silicon environments in the PCIe technology
Collaborate with other teams in the PCIe group, software, and architecture teams to define and craft legacy and new low-level firmware verification methods
Improve the existing automated process
What we need to see:
B.Sc. or equivalent experience in Electrical Engineering / Computer Science / Computer Engineering
8+ years of experience in FW design and Verification
OOP / computer structure / operating system
Experience in Real-Time or embedded software development is an advantage
Problem solver, Independent and curious
Strong interpersonal skills and self-learning ability
Strong multi-disciplinary capabilities and ability to work with a wide interface of people – chip design, verification, FW, SW, architecture
Ways to stand out from the crowd:
Knowledge of Hardware verification concepts and tools (C++, Python, GIT, Jenkins automation, HW familiarity and TDD oriented)
Experience partnering with software and arch teams to define and implement firmware
Knowledge in networking, Linux and scripting languages
Experience with in-depth problems solving
NVIDIA is committed to encouraging a diverse work environment and proud to be an equal opportunity employer. As we highly value diversity in our current and future employees, we do not discriminate (including in our hiring and promotion practices) on the basis of race, religion, color, national origin, gender, gender expression, sexual orientation, age, marital status, disability status or any other characteristic protected by law.

